Tuesday Oct. 9, 6-8 pm

Cooking with Wild Seasonal Foods

Join wild foods enthusiast and herbalist Iris Weaver in discovering some of the wonderfully tasty and nutritious vegetables and other delectables that grow in your yard or the city park.
Learn to identify some of these foods, understand safety guidelines, and taste some recipes to whet your appetite!
Handouts and samples included.
Iris Weaver is an herbalist and educator with over 30 years experience.
She has an herbal business, making and selling herbal products locally, as well as teaching classes and doing consultations.
Iris is also an avid gardener, and grows many of the herbs she works with and uses in her classes.
